“My Shepherd”

Psalm 23

When you think of Jesus Christ, what or who do you envision? Is he a thin Man with a beard about 30-40 yrs. of age, is he a baby in a manger in Bethlehem, is he floating on a cloud with cupid… you get my drift… Jesus was born as a normal baby, he did grow to be 30+, died and rose from the grave; yes he is in heaven, but not with cupid on the clouds but, with the Father -(God Eternal Immortal;) interceding for us. So, when you think of Jesus what do you envision, do you believe(act out) on what you read about Him? While the battle is not ours, but the lords, it means a lot who we want to win the war for us. While it’s easier said than done to trust God when we’re so engrossed with the issues and pains of life, he has a proven track record throughout the ages of being with his people in times of trouble. So delivering us from all sorts of calamities is a light thing for Jesus. As sheep we’re so naïve and scary, and so prone to wonder away from God, but with God, he gently corrects us and puts us back into our wealthy places. God also promised to provide, he said to seek first his kingdom and to put on all of his righteousness, then all the desires of our hearts will be added to us. So, if Jesus is our shepherd we need only trust in his delivering power; being that he created us, and defeated our enemy and all.
